Failure of phase-matching concept in large-signal parametric frequency conversion

Abstract: Four-wave mixing experiments in a low-birefringence optical fiber reveal an unexpected sudden increase of the conversion efficiency as the signal power crosses a threshold value. In this regime, peak frequency conversion is achieved outside the small-signal parametric gain spectrum. A nonlinear model of wave mixing fits the measured data well.
